Business coaching in the UK is booming, and for good reason. It offers a structured approach to unlocking your potential and achieving your business aspirations. But with so many options available, how do you choose the right coach for you? This guide will walk you through the key considerations, from identifying your needs to understanding the different coaching styles.
First, consider what you want to achieve through coaching. Are you looking to improve your leadership skills, boost your sales performance, or develop a more strategic mindset? Once you have a clear understanding of your goals, you can start researching coaches who specialize in those areas. Look for coaches with a proven track record of success and who have experience working with businesses in the UK.
Finally, remember that the best coaching relationship is built on trust and rapport. Schedule introductory calls with a few different coaches to see who you connect with best. Don’t be afraid to ask questions and share your concerns. A good coach will be able to listen to your needs and provide you with a clear plan of action.
